Position Summary:
The Advanced Process Engineering Sr. Manager will direct and coordinate the planning and completion of manufacturing production, process, tooling, gaging, and plant engineering projects with relation to product production. Will assist plants in achieving launch targets, OEE improvements, and lean Initiatives.
Primary Responsibilities:
Direct engineering activities relative to manufacture of automotive products
Support and develop quotations for new business opportunities
Develop capital/tooling spending plans/requirements, and implement appropriate aspects of capital plan
Oversee the design, acquisition, and installation of capital equipment and tooling to meet production and financial requirements
Apply understanding of the business and how own team contributes to the achievement of results
Manage professional employees and/or supervisors
Provide and update equipment to support current manufacturing requirements
Coordinate with quality and production and provide necessary support to meet company objectives
Direct efforts for tooling, manufacturing process, plant engineering, and maintenance project management
Ensure clear communication of lessons learned are shared within their respective department and across other departments
Identify and resolves complex technical, operational and organizations problem
Guide by policies, resource requirements, budgets and the business plan
Accountable for the performance and results of a team within own discipline
Drive new and innovative ideas for process improvements
Guide, influence and persuade other either internally in other areas or externally with customers or agencies
Provide knowledge of material and process costs to support manufacturing
Provide health, and safety requirements in support of tooling, equipment, and CLauS deliverables
Responsible for the development and implementation of engineering standards
May, on occasion, be required to perform duties other than those specified in this description
Education and Qualifications:
Bachelor degree in engineering preferred; Masters or other advanced degree is a plus
Minimum of five years’ prior leadership experience preferred
Ability to apply understanding of the business and how own team contributes to the achievement of results
Ability to make decisions guided by policies, procedure and business plan; receives guidance from manager
Minimum of ten years’ experience in process engineering, tooling, equipment, and process improvement
Requires in-depth understanding and application of concepts, theories and principles in own discipline and basic knowledge of other disciplines
Excellent verbal and written communications skills and the ability to effectively interface with all levels of hourly and management personnel, both inside and outside of the company.
Working knowledge of customer functional performance requirements
Strong technical problem-solving skills, project management, and statistical process control capability
Strong understanding of MRP, quality control, purchasing, accounting
Knowledge of Core Quality Tools: FMEA, APQP, PPAP, MSA, SPC.
Knowledge of Problem-Solving Tools (8D, 5 Why, Cause and Effect, etc.).
Knowledge of Problem-Solving techniques (6 Sigma, Kaizen, Kepner Tregoe, etc.).
Strong manufacturing engineering skills and understanding of shop floor routings
Experience with profile extrusion and injection molding of TPE & PVC preferred
Microsoft Office proficient
